Ask for Your Real Estate Agent’s License
Before you hire a real estate agent, the first thing you as a client need to know is whether the agent you are hiring is genuine or not. The license of your real estate agent will solve this issue for you.
Being a client of any real estate agent, you are free to ask for their license. Having a license will give you the surety that you are working with a professional. Someone professional in their work will not hesitate to let you see their license. If any agent denies doing so, take it as a sign of finding a new agent.

Who are your agents’ primary Clients?
Real estate agents work with both buyers and sellers. They might not have the same number of clients from both parties. The number of clients your agent has worked with can tell you on which side the agent has worked frequently.
If you are a house buyer and the agent has most clients as buyers, they can easily help you out as they have more experience on the buyers’ side.
In case you are a seller being skeptical of selecting an agent with fewer house seller clients, you can look for another agent.
